A week in the life of a Cybersecurity Engineer:



  • Participate in Cybersecurity assessments to include conducting residual risk analysis and compiling Risk Management Framework for DoD IT artifacts.
  • Research and recommend cybersecurity architectures and procedures, providing advanced systems administration and executing cybersecurity vulnerability testing in mixed network environments.
  • Participate in technical meetings, providing cybersecurity services and systems administration for military tactical/non-tactical, Electronics Support Measures suites and relational database applications.
  • Provide input to monthly cyber security analysis reports.

Job Requirements

  • Bachelor of Science degree in Information Technology field or six years of military IT experience.
  • DoD 8570.1-M Cybersecurity Technician Level II or III certifications (e.g., CompTIA Security+/Network+, or Certified Information Systems Security Professional (CISSP) and operating systems certification (e.g.). Microsoft Technology Professional, CompTIA Linux+ and Cisco Certified Network Administrator (CCNA).
  • Active Secret security clearance


At least 3+ years' experience in:



  • Cybersecurity, Risk Management Framework, and/or Information Technology/networks.
  • Using Enterprise Mission Assurance Support Service (eMass)
  • Familiarity with information systems vulnerability scanning tools, e.g., DISA Security Technical
  • Implementation Guides (STIG), Assured Compliance Assessment Reports Security Readiness Review (SRR) scripts, and implementation.
  • MS Windows 10 and Server operating systems and UNIX/Linux, Solaris, VMware, Real-Time Operating Systems, routers, and embedded processor networking environments.
